    Cathie has been awarded a contract to provide geophysical and geotechnical consultancy services for the up to 1.7 GW Bluepoint Wind offshore wind project in the United States. Located 38 nautical miles off the coast of New York and 53 nautical miles off the coast of New Jersey, Bluepoint Wind offshore wind project is being […]

    More favourable weather conditions and less waves have really jump-started the wind turbine installation in Anholt Offshore Wind Farm. At the end of April, a total of 97 wind turbines had been installed in the wind farm. Now, only 14 wind turbines need to be installed before all 111 wind turbines have been installed. Of […]

    DEME Offshore has completed the installation of the 94 Siemens Gamesa 8 MW turbines at the Borssele 1 & 2 offshore wind farm in the Netherlands. DEME’s jack-up tandem Sea Installer and Sea Challenger were in charge of the installation at the site located 22km off the coast of the province of Zeeland. The first turbine was […]
